"Orange Harvest" in Exeter California, my hometown. Beautiful mural
I was born in Exeter California back in 1972. Exeter is at the foothills of the Sierra Nevada in the Central Valley of California.
A couple miles north of town is California State route 198 that takes you to the Sequoia National Park.
Exeter is famous for oranges and murals. The downtown is decorated with several beautiful murals.
The oldest and biggest mural happens to be an orange orchard at harvest time. The "Orange Harvest" mural is at the heart of the small downtown.
